Adding line ups as the game goes

Post by Tguerr16 » Sat Mar 16, 2013 6:50 pm

How can I (if there is a way) add the players/line up as they come to the plate?

Re: Adding line ups as the game goes

Post by FTMSupport » Sat Mar 16, 2013 8:27 pm

The suggested approach if you are scoring for a team you don't know would be to create a Quick Rosters for the opponent with the number of players you expect to bat (err on the side of too many). As each player comes to the plate, you can edit the player's name / number to match the current batter. When you see the first batter back in the on deck circle, go to Misc -> Show Starting Lineup and set the remaining players to Batting = NO.
